Yankees deal for Frazier, Robertson, Kahnle
CHICAGO - The New York Yankees acquired infielder Todd Frazier and relievers David Robertson and Tommy Kahnle from the Chicago White Sox for reliever Tyler Clippard and three prospects.
The deal was announced Tuesday night, less than two weeks before the nonwaiver trade deadline.
Tour de France rookie Roglic wins Stage 17
BRIANCON, France - Speeding downhill at 75 kph (45 mph) on unprotected Alpine roads, Tour de France rookie Primoz Roglic scaled the race’s highest peak and then barreled down the other side while holding off the competition on the famed Galibier climb to win Stage 17.
Chris Froome consolidated his overall lead as Fabio Aru lost touch with the three-time champion’s group on the punishing gradients of the Galibier.

Crafton wins on dirt at Eldora, ends drought
ROSSBURG, Ohio - Matt Crafton won the Dirt Derby at Eldora Speedway on Wednesday night for his first NASCAR Camping World Truck Series victory in more than a year.
The two-time series champion passed Stewart Friesen with 16 laps to go and won by 1.96 seconds in his No. 88 Toyota. Crafton won for the first time since May 2016 at Charlotte.
